LICHFIELD CARPET CLEANING FIRM SUPPORTS ST GILES HOSPICE TO FUND CARE SERVICES FOR LOCAL FAMILIES

Knight & Doyle Carpet and Upholstery Cleaning has signed up as a corporate supporter for St Giles and pledged to donate more than £2,500 to the hospice from its cleaning sales each year.

The business is also offering St Giles Hospice lottery players a 10 per cent discount of their services through the lottery’s Promise Card scheme.

Knight & Doyle, which offers residential and commercial carpet cleaning services across Lichfield, Cannock, Walsall, Aldridge and surrounding areas, has now rebranded its vans to promote the firm’s support of St Giles and will feature its logo on its website and in marketing materials to further raise awareness of the hospice.

Rich (corr) Doyle, a partner in Knight & Doyle, said: "We wanted to support a local charity and when we looked at St Giles Hospice and the work that it does we knew that we had found the right cause.

“When we heard about the support that patients get out in the community and the bereavement services on offer to patients’ families we realised that St Giles is not just a place where people go to die - it’s so much more than that. It’s about caring for patients and their families out in the community as well. 

“Knight & Doyle are fortunate because as a business we have been so well supported by the community – and by helping a vital local charity like St Giles we can give a little back to support local people in return.”

Chloe Herbert, Head of Fundraising at St Giles, said the hospice was absolutely thrilled that Knight & Doyle had signed up to support its work caring for patients living with a terminal illness and their families at a time when demand for its services was significantly increasing.

"In a tough year which has been so hard for everyone, it is absolutely wonderful to receive this support from Knight & Doyle," she said. “Businesses and charities alike have been challenged by the Covid-19 pandemic so their generosity is particularly welcome and inspiring right now, and our message to all of our supporters is that we’ve never needed you more than we need you today.

"There are so many ways that businesses can support St Giles, and the financial support of companies like Knight & Doyle is vital in helping us to be able to keep running our services.

“By becoming a corporate partner and signing up for our Promise Card scheme, Knight & Doyle are supporting our fundraising, our weekly lottery and our Promise Card scheme, ensuring that we can continue to provide our care services which make such a difference to local families.

"Knight & Doyle operate across the hospice catchment area, so if you use their services and you play the hospice lottery you can use your Promise Card to receive a further 10 per cent discount."

Players who sign up to the St Giles lottery receive an exclusive Promise Card as a thank you for their support. The Promise Card entitles players to exclusive savings at over 150 shops and outlets across the region  including 10 per cent off in the hospice’s high street charity shops.
